Books

This year, I decided to up my ante and read more books this year even I’m juggling multiple things. I set my reading challenge at 7 books and I passed that goal and read 10 books. The previous year was 7 books.

So what books did I read this year?

  • Contagious: Why Things Catch On — Jonah Berger
  • Boys & Sex: Young Men on Hookups, Love, Porn, Consent, and Navigating the New Masculinity — Peggy Orenstein
  • Press Reset: Ruin and Recovery in the Video Game Industry — Jason Schreier
  • Liftoff: Elon Musk and the Desperate Early Days That Launched SpaceX — Eric Berger
  • How to Avoid a Climate Disaster: The Solutions We Have and the Breakthroughs We Need — Bill Gates
  • The End of Gender: Debunking the Myths about Sex and Identity in Our Society — Debra Soh
  • Everybody Lies: Big Data, New Data, and What the Internet Can Tell Us About Who We Really Are — Seth Stephens-Davidowitz
  • Blood, Sweat, and Pixels: The Triumphant, Turbulent Stories Behind How Video Games Are Made — Jason Schreier
  • Broken (in the best possible way) — Jenny Lawson

Tech Nova

My online tech news publication, Tech Nova, did well this year. We had a small slow down in the middle of the year but picked it in the later part of 2021.

We’ve published 361 articles and counting in 2021. We crossed the milestone of 1000 followers on Instagram and 2000 followers on Twitter.

We didn’t do as well compared to last year when we looked at 2020 numbers. Last year we had about 61,000 unique visitors to the website. Currently, we’re doing half those numbers. We have about 35,000 unique visitors and we’re on pace to have about 40,000.

That’s not too bad considering we’re relying mostly on SEO and social media (Twitter and Instagram).
